2016-2017 Campus Reading of The Undergraduate Experience

During the 2016-17 year, faculty and staff members across campus engaged in a conversation about how we can focus on what matters most here at SFA.

More than 550 individuals from across campus received a copy of The Undergraduate Experience - Focusing Institutions on What Matters Most; many individuals took part in small group discussions during their reading.

All readers were invited to help in forming action recommendations for the university. In a series of sessions during the academic year, Dr. Bob Szafran led attendees in exercises designed to identify the most useful ideas in the book and convert them into concrete, achievable initiatives for SFA.

The outcomes of those sessions are listed below.
